abstract = "This book is devoted to regularity and fractal properties of superprocesses with (1 +β)-branching. Regularity properties of functions is the most classical question in analysis. Typically one is interested in such properties as continuity/discontinuity and differentiability. Starting from Weierstrass, who constructed an example of a continuous but nowhere differentiable function, people got more and more interested in such “strange” properties of functions. Trajectories of stochastic processes give a rich source of such functions.",
